做OCR身份证识别的调研,正好整理一下从基础的图像处理角度的算法流程。OCR简介光学字符识别 Optical Character Recognition(OCR)其目标是对图像中的字符进行分析识别,将其转换为文本格式的字符序列。利用模式识别和数字图像处理技术,解决文字输入问题。按输入方式分类印刷体文字手写体文字(由扫描仪输入/由手写板输入)按识别字符集分类英文,中文,日文,韩文等中文,常用4000
转载
2023-10-10 07:41:57
238阅读
,为2019 CCF BDCI比赛基于OCR的身份证要素提取一等奖获奖团队技术方案分享是,不仅有方案,还开源了代码,非常值得相关同学参考!基于OCR的身份证要素提取赛题信息出题单位:兴业银行赛题类型:第一赛道-算法题技术方向:分类预测, 数据挖掘赛题背景市面上的身份证识别模型,尚不能满足银行质量参差的影像识别需求,一个具备强抗噪声干扰能力的OCR模型有着极高的商业价值。赛题任务根据训练数
## 使用Java进行身份证OCR
在现代社会,身份证是每个公民必备的证件之一。但是在某些场景下,需要对身份证进行识别和提取信息。为了方便进行身份证信息的识别,可以使用OCR(Optical Character Recognition)技术。本文将介绍如何使用Java进行身份证OCR,并提供相应的代码示例。
### 身份证OCR原理
OCR技术是一种能够将图像中的文本信息转换为可编辑文本的技
原创
2024-06-20 05:31:34
81阅读
简介 一、介绍 身份证识别 API 接口文档地址:http://ai.baidu.com/docs#/OCR-API/top 接口描述 用户向服务请求识别身份证,身份证识别包括正面和背面。 请求说明 请求示例 HTTP 方法:POST 请求URL: https://aip.baidubce.com/rest/2.0/ocr/v1/idcard&nbs
转载
2024-08-31 14:45:39
99阅读
摘要:由Web Service和其相关网站接收客户端上传的需要识别的图片。当Web Service接收到图片后将其转发给调度服务器,由任务调度程序再把识别请求分发给空闲的识别服务器,终由Web Service将结果返回给客户端。身份证OCR识别开发包是基于移动端的身份证OCR识别应用程序,支持Android、iOS两种主流移动操作系统。该产品采用手机、平板电脑等带有摄像头的设备拍摄身份证原件,通过
转载
2024-08-09 08:21:48
45阅读
## 实现Python OCR身份证的步骤表格
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 安装必要的库和依赖项 |
| 步骤2 | 准备身份证图片 |
| 步骤3 | 图像预处理 |
| 步骤4 | 使用OCR进行身份证识别 |
| 步骤5 | 输出识别结果 |
## 每一步的代码实现和注释
### 步骤1:安装必要的库和依赖项
在开始之前,我们需要安装一些必要的
原创
2023-11-08 06:14:47
78阅读
文章目录前言序言一、身份证号码介绍1.身份证号码组成2.省份证号码中的名词解释1.区域代码(地址码)2.生日3.顺序码4.校验码总结二、校验码计算1.公式拆解2.运算三、实现思路1.伪代码2.代码实现参考资料 前言最近在工作中需要对用户的身份证号码进行强校验(严格校验),然后用于实名认证。看到这个需求时,我心想这还不简单,一个正则表达式就可以搞定了。但是想法很美好,现实很残酷,狠狠的抽了我一个大
转载
2024-07-09 21:28:51
111阅读
安卓手机扫描/拍照识别身份证使用了成熟的OCR文字识别技术,通过手机或者带有摄像头的终端设备对身份证描/拍照,并对证件做OCR文字识别,提取身份证信息。此技术越来越被广大消费用户认知并使用。优点是:方案成本低,用于智能手机,使用环境方便,功能容易扩展。
近几年,各种各样的APP正
转载
2024-05-23 19:30:28
21阅读
一、需求和算法需求使用 Java 中 util 包通过键盘输入身份证号。使用算法校验身份证号是否合法。根据身份证号获取用户出生地。根据身份证号获取用户生日。根据身份证号获取用户性别。打印出生地、生日、性别。算法取出身份证号前 17 位与指定系数相乘。系数表如下:把相乘的结果累加起来。用累加结果对 11 求余。根据余数对应下表找到身份证号的末尾数。判断用户输入的身份证号最后一位与余数对应的尾数是否相
转载
2023-08-14 21:44:05
30阅读
OCR文字识别使用场景: 对于电商中的分销机制,是需要用户上传身份证或者银行卡的,由于身份证号码(18位/15位),银行卡(19位/17位/16位),位数较多,在用户输入时,有些繁琐。以支付宝绑定银行卡为例,可以通过拍照的方式,自动检测银行卡中的卡号信息,如果有错误的数字,还可以进行二次修改。身份证的信息也是如此,此时就需要用到OCR文字识别。百度/腾讯/阿里 都有OCR百度OCR网址:https
转载
2024-06-29 12:17:23
105阅读
## Java OCR身份证识别实现流程
### 步骤概述
下面是实现Java OCR身份证识别的步骤概述:
| 步骤 | 描述 |
| --- | --- |
| 1 | 导入OCR库 |
| 2 | 设置OCR引擎 |
| 3 | 加载身份证图片 |
| 4 | 进行身份证识别 |
| 5 | 获取识别结果 |
### 详细步骤及代码示例
#### 1. 导入OCR库
首先,你需要导入
原创
2023-07-16 08:13:47
567阅读
# **OCR识别身份证 Java**
身份证号码是我们在日常生活中经常需要使用的重要证件信息,但是有时候我们需要对身份证号码进行OCR识别,以便更好地进行信息管理和验证。在本文中,我们将介绍如何使用Java语言进行身份证号码的OCR识别。
## **OCR技术介绍**
OCR(Optical Character Recognition)光学字符识别技术是一种将图像中的文本内容转换为可编辑文
原创
2024-05-05 04:28:45
223阅读
# 基于Java的OCR身份证识别技术
在现代社会中,身份证是每个人身份的象征,广泛用于身份验证、金融交易等场景。随着科技的飞速发展,光学字符识别(OCR)技术为身份证的自动识别提供了便利。本文将介绍如何使用Java实现OCR身份证识别,并带有简单的代码示例。
## 什么是OCR?
光学字符识别(OCR)是一种将图像中的文本转换成可编辑和可搜索的文本的技术。OCR技术广泛应用于文档数字化、自
## Java OCR识别身份证实现流程
### 1. 准备工作
在实现Java OCR识别身份证之前,我们需要准备以下工作:
- 安装Java开发环境(JDK)
- 下载并安装Tesseract OCR引擎
- 导入相关依赖库
### 2. 实现步骤
为了更好地理解整个实现流程,我们可以使用表格来展示每个步骤及其对应的代码和注释。
| 步骤 | 代码 | 说明 |
| --- | ---
原创
2023-10-10 03:28:35
747阅读
课程讲师:腾讯云高级工程师 彭碧发讲师简介:毕业于华中科技大学,负责智能图像相关AI产品,熟悉AI视觉工程化,对计算机图像处理有一定的理解,现担任腾讯云大数据及人工智能产品中心高级工程师。那么直播中有哪些值得关注的内容呢?学习君和你一起来回顾一下!OCR通俗来说就是让计算机看图识字的技术,比如在生活中,使用手机可以对身份证进行拍照,并通过一种技术将身份证照片上的文字自动转换成文本信息,这种技术就是
包括只有2个文件,video.py是测试在线摄像头的代码,IDrec.py是识别身份证的代码。使
原创
2022-11-10 10:21:01
1049阅读
# 在Java中实现OCR识别身份证
光学字符识别(OCR)技术可以将图像中的文字信息提取出来。在本文中,我们将学习如何在Java中实现识别身份证的OCR功能。首先,我们将概述整个流程,然后逐步深入每个步骤。
## 流程概述
以下是整体实现流程的步骤:
| 步骤 | 描述 |
|------|------|
| 1 | 准备开发环境 |
| 2 | 导入OCR库 |
| 3
# Java身份证OCR识别实现教程
## 整体流程
下面是实现Java身份证OCR识别的整体流程:
```mermaid
sequenceDiagram
小白->>经验丰富的开发者: 请求帮助实现Java身份证OCR识别
经验丰富的开发者-->>小白: 接受请求并开始教导
小白->>经验丰富的开发者: 按照步骤进行实现
```
## 实现步骤
以下是实现Java
原创
2024-03-02 07:20:08
106阅读
# Java OCR 身份证识别
## 引言
随着数字化时代的到来,对身份证信息的识别和处理需求也越来越多。OCR(Optical Character Recognition,光学字符识别)技术因其高精度和高效性而被广泛应用于身份证识别领域。本文将介绍如何使用Java编程语言实现身份证的OCR识别,并给出相关的代码示例。
## OCR 身份证识别原理
OCR 身份证识别的原理是通过图像处理
原创
2023-12-16 05:30:01
290阅读
一、身份证扫一扫识别的技术应用背景这些年,随着移动互联网的的发展,越来越多的企业都推出了自己的移动APP,这些APP多数都涉及到个人身份证信息的输入认证(即实名认证),如果手动去输入身份证号码和姓名,速度非常慢,且用户体验非常差。为了提高在移动终端上输入身份证信息的速度和准确性,我们开发出身份证扫一扫识别的技术SDK,以满足各行业应用需求,给用户带来更好的体验。只需将身份证扫一扫识别的
转载
2024-08-09 17:18:22
104阅读